Why 'Service Call' Prices Aren't the Whole Story
A dangerous misconception about finding a locksmith near me is focusing solely on the lowest quoted service call fee. However, suspiciously low upfront costs often mask exorbitant labor charges or drilling surcharges that appear only after the work is done. A trustworthy automotive locksmith or residential expert will always provide a transparent total estimate over the phone, including potential complications. If you are locked out, specifically ask for the total labor cost for entry, not just the trip fee. Reputable businesses in Seattle are committed to honest pricing structures. Whether you require a car key fob replacement or a deadbolt installation, clarity on costs before arrival is the primary sign of a professional.

Security Upgrades: Beyond Simple Lock Replacement
Many homeowners believe that changing locks is too complicated and unnecessary if keys are simply misplaced. However, a Seattle locksmith can quickly rekey your existing hardware to invalidate old keys, a process often faster and cheaper than full replacement. For older homes with aging doors, upgrading to smart locks or high-security deadbolts offers better protection against picking techniques and forced entry. A qualified mobile locksmith can also assess your door’s alignment and frame integrity, which are common issues in vintage Seattle housing. Investing in these specific upgrades through a licensed professional ensures your home remains secure against modern threats without requiring a completely new door installation.
Identifying Scammers Before They Drill Your Door
A significant warning sign that most people overlook is a technician who insists on drilling your lock immediately upon arrival. Scammers frequently claim a lock is unpickable to force you into buying an expensive replacement unit. A skilled Seattle locksmith possesses the advanced tools and training to open almost any residential or automotive lock non-destructively. If the price you were quoted doubles onsite or the technician applies high-pressure tactics, stop the service immediately. Trustworthy pros always prioritize non-destructive entry methods first. If you are hiring for automotive locksmith services or home security, always verify their reputation through local review platforms and licensing boards.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can a Seattle locksmith make a key for my car without the original?
Yes, a licensed automotive locksmith can cut and program a new key or fob using your vehicle's identification number, even without the original present.
How do I check if a locksmith near me is legally licensed in Seattle?
Ask for the company's Washington State UBI number and verify it against the state business registry, ensuring they carry adequate insurance for your protection.
Should I rekey my locks after buying a home in the greater Seattle area?
Absolutely, you never know who retained copies of your keys, so hiring a local locksmith to rekey ensures you and your family are the only key holders.
